About Medicines and Healthcare products Regulatory Agency
The Medicines and Healthcare products Regulatory Agency, an executive agency of the Department of Health and Social Care, exists to enhance and improve the health of millions of people every day through the effective regulation of medicines and medical devices, underpinned by science and research.
We deliver this through three distinct yet complimentary business centres: the MHRA regulatory centre, the National Institute for Biological Standards and Control (NIBSC) and the Clinical Practice Research Datalink (CPRD).
